Program Overview

Offered by the Faculty of Transportation Systems and Mechanical Engineering, this program provides theoretical training and practical expertise in areas such as machine systems, design, robotics, mechanics, and production technologies. Students learn to design, test, maintain, and innovate mechanical equipment across different industries.

Admission Requirements

General Admission Requirements

  • Valid PassportRequired

    Must be valid for at least 6 months beyond your intended period of stay.

  • Recorded InterviewRequired

    A video interview must be completed through our online admission portal. The interview will be recorded and reviewed by the university admission committee.

  • High School DiplomaRequired

    A high school diploma or equivalent certificate is required.

  • English Language Proficiency

    CEFR B2 level is required. Accepted tests include TOEFL, IELTS, or equivalents.
